Trustus Logistics
Managing shipping data across several carrier systems is a challenge for many companies. This organization’s main goal is to increase visibility through organized digital collaboration. Its program collects operational information from various carrier interfaces. The technology transforms disorganized records into comprehensible, practical shipment data. The tools establish connections with tracking feeds, booking systems, and carrier databases. These connections simultaneously gather status updates from several service providers. Consolidated cargo details are viewed by users via a single operational interface. The system arranges order references, movement histories, and status updates coherently.
Companies steer clear of manually checking several carrier websites or communication channels. The organization’s strategy is centered on data consolidation. A shared digital environment receives information from several providers. For uniform reporting and analysis, the program standardizes formats. Operations teams evaluate the quality of services provided by various transportation partners. Additionally, managers use organized operational dashboards to examine shipment trends. Customer service, dispatch planning, and procurement are all examples of useful business applications. Retail companies monitor shipments from suppliers using multiple contracted carriers.
E-commerce staff do not switch between carrier systems when reviewing parcel transit. When a buyer inquires, customer care departments check the shipping status. Additionally, the program helps accounting teams with records related to shipping verification. The company does not manage transportation assets or transfer goods. It does not supervise freight handling, cars, or warehouse activity. Rather, in complex shipping situations, the organization concentrates on information clarity. Its systems facilitate communication between companies and the carriers they have selected. This strategy aids businesses in keeping control over operational choices and shipment data.
